EPC Services Company, a leading power / utility engineering consultant and construction firm, has immediate openings for full-time Senior Project Managers throughout the country.

Consideration for a remote-work arrangement will be based on a candidate's level of industry experience in Project Management.

This position is a senior professional project management role for individuals with advanced skills related to the strategic planning and management of the construction for electrical power, communications, and industrial facilities, including civil, structural, and mechanical disciplines.

A senior project manager is a key resource to general and executive managers in providing insight and counsel on high-level business management decisions.

The position of Senior Project Manager is an essential role in the organization. It provides critical leadership and management in the execution of Engineering, Procurement, and Construction turnkey projects (EPC).

Its functions include program management for large clients, general project management, project financial, bidding, safety, field support, general administration, and training / mentoring of Project Managers and Assistant Project Managers.

This position typically reports directly to the Branch Manager however, they may be reporting to the General Manager, Vice President, or President directly depending on the client and the project that they are managing.

Assistant Project Managers and Project Managers may be assigned to work with a Senior Project Manager depending on the program or project requirements.

Occasional travel may is required for the monitoring and control of construction projects.

Minimum Requirements : Bachelor of Science in Electrical Engineering, Electrical Engineering Technology, or Construction Management and a minimum of 10 years' project management experience with complex projects in transmission line or substation construction or a combination of education and experience of high-voltage electrical systems;

prior experience in electrical design of substations / switchyards a plus. Excellent organizational skills; effective written and verbal communication skills.

Proficiency with Microsoft Excel including basic spreadsheet structure, formatting, conditional formatting, shortcuts, basic formulas and keyboard navigation controls;

experience with Vista (Viewpoint) software a plus. The successful applicant must possess the ability to pass all Company and client-mandated drug and background checking.

Occasional travel / driving is required; therefore, the successful applicant will be subject to EPC Services' auto insurance carrier requirements.

Ap plicants must not require sponsorship for employment visa status (e.g., H-1B visa status) now or in the future.

EPC Services Company and its parent, Electrical Consultants, Inc. (ECI), employ over 950 engineers, designers, project managers, surveyors, ROW agents, environmental planners, construction professionals and support staff in 26+ offices across the U.

S. The firm has 35 years of experience in the planning, engineering, and construction of a wide range of power delivery projects including substations, transmission lines, distribution systems, communication systems and industrial facilities.
